Conventional current flows in the direction of the fingers, then magnetic field within the winding is in the direction of the thumb. The rule also works for magnetic field around a current. In mathematics and physics, the right-hand rule is a common mnemonic for understanding the orientation of axes in three-dimensional space. It is also a convenient method for quickly finding the direction of a cross-product of 2 vectors. Most of the various left-hand and right-hand rules arise from the fact that the three axes of three-dimensional space have two possible orientations.
